Output 80a51fdd71ddcc2a8db55907984aa6539c8171e3f1586ca4fb0fdfc29c28f054:0

value
153173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ac95d4e8d0691286571badee1583287de190021c OP_EQUAL
address
3HRZe2TsB5Beq3s5N25diDwFahd6ZAuEym
transaction
80a51fdd71ddcc2a8db55907984aa6539c8171e3f1586ca4fb0fdfc29c28f054
spent
true